The University of Louisville re-introduced Mike Summers back to the program as its Offensive Line Coach. Summers was previously the offensive line coach at UofL from 2003-2006 during Bobby Petrino’s 1st stint with the Cardinals. Summers went to the Atlanta Falcons & Arkansas with Coach Petrino and also was with Kentucky, USC and most recently with the Florida Gators. Here is Coach Summers’ full introductory press conference:
